1. Understanding the Nutritional Needs of Border Collies:

Before we dive into the best food options for Border Collies, it is important to understand their nutritional needs. Border Collies are high-energy dogs, which means they require a lot of calories to fuel their daily activities. They also require a balanced diet that is rich in protein, healthy fats, and vitamins and minerals. Here are some of the key nutritional requirements of Border Collies:

– Protein: Border Collies require high levels of protein to maintain their muscle mass and support their active lifestyle. The protein should come from high-quality animal sources such as chicken, beef, fish, or lamb.

– Fat: Border Collies need healthy fats to provide them with energy. Look for dog food that contains healthy fats like om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ids.

– Carbohydrates: Border Collies need carbohydrates to provide them with energy, but they should come from healthy sources such as sweet potatoes, brown rice, and legumes.

– Vitamins and minerals: Border Collies require a balanced diet that provides them with all the essential vitamins and minerals to keep them healthy and active.

3. Tips for Switching Your Border Collie’s Diet:

If you are planning to switch your Border Collie’s diet, it is important to do it gradually to avoid upsetting their digestive system. Here are some tips to help you make the transition:

– Start by mixing a small amount of the new food with their old food, gradually increasing the amount over the course of a week.

– Monitor your dog’s digestive system during the transition. If you notice any signs of upset stomach, diarrhea, or vomiting, slow down the transition process.

– Make sure your Border Collie has access to plenty of fresh water during the transition.
